      ** CNC Programmer/Setup/Operator II

      Dwyer Instruments

      Swedesboro, NJ 08085

      $34.25-$39.25/hr
      Onsite

      • Analyze, install, test, review program to increase operating efficiency.
      • Calculates and sets controls to regulate machining factors such as speed, feed, coolant flow, depth, and angles.
      • Reviews drawings, blueprints, sketches, manuals, or sample parts to determine sequence of operations, and setup requirements.
      • Selects, aligns, and secures holding fixtures, cutting tools, attachments, accessories, and materials on machines. Checks for functionality and performance.
      • Input or retrieve the correct program code from the machine and network.
      • Able to run manual equipment.
      • Monitors assigned operators to ensure parts are produced correctly.
      • Basic computer skills including Word, Outlook, and Excel
      • Write and modify CNC programs for 4 to 8 axis machines to machine parts per print/drawing.
      • Able to take a job from print to finished part.
      • Perform first piece inspections and in-process quality control checks by using tools such as micrometers, calipers, depth gages, go no-go gages, comparators, etc.
      • Understand M & G codes and how they are used to command the machine.
      • Stand for long periods of time.
      • Performs routine maintenance on machines and equipment.
      • Knowledge of SolidWorks 3D modeling software.
      • Confers with Supervision, area leaders, programmers, engineers, or others to resolve machining or assembly issues.
      • Ability to verify parts using quality measuring devices.
      • Maintains acceptable levels of production according to established standards.
      • Able to use CAM software to program CNC machines.
      • Knowledge of various types of CNC Lathes including 3 and 4 axis machines.
      • Mentors other CNC Personnel.
      • Completes required paperwork routing sheet, time sheet etc.
      • Able to lean and reach.
      • Ability to lift up to 50 lbs.
      • Change tooling and offsets when necessary to assure product is meeting tolerances and specifications.
      • Must be an experienced, skilled machinist.
      • Ability to interpret drawings, blueprints, and written / verbal instructions with limited supervision to setup and operate CNC equipment.
